چکیده مقاله:

This study investigates and compares the impact of various FACTS (Flexible AC TransmissionSystems) devices, specifically SVC (Static VAR Compensator), STATCOM (Static SynchronousCompensator), TCSC (Thyristor Controlled Series Capacitor), and UPFC (Unified Power FlowController), on improving the stability of a sample power network. The primary objective is to enhancethe stability of the network under different operational conditions, including nominal and peak loadscenarios. The results demonstrate that UPFC consistently outperforms the other FACTS devices interms of efficiency, effectively mitigating the magnitude and intensity of voltage fluctuations. Thiscapability enables a quicker damping of oscillations, leading to significant improvements in overallpower system stability. The findings underscore the superiority of UPFC in enhancing the performanceof electrical networks, particularly during critical operating conditions.
